Punishing: Gray Raven is a sci-fi action RPG developed and published by Kuro Games.
Originally released in China in 2019 and later launched globally in July 2021, the game has captivated players with its fast paced hack and slash combat, deep character progression, and immersive storytelling.
Set in a post-apocalyptic world overrun by a deadly Punishing Virus, the game challenges players to lead a team of elite warriors, known as Constructs, in humanity’s battle for survival. Its highly responsive combat mechanics, fluid animations, and compelling narrative set it apart from other mobile action RPGs, drawing comparisons to titles like Honkai Impact 3rd.
What is Punishing: Gray Raven?
Setting: A World Ravaged by the Punishing Virus
The world of Punishing: Gray Raven is a dystopian wasteland, where a mysterious and deadly virus has turned machines into hostile entities known as Corrupted. These mechanized abominations now roam the Earth, forcing humanity’s last survivors to take refuge in Babylonia, an orbital space station.
Player’s Role: The Commandant of Gray Raven
Players assume the role of the Commandant, the leader of an elite strike force known as Gray Raven. Tasked with reclaiming Earth, the Commandant must command a squad of Constructs, human minds implanted into cybernetic bodies, who possess unique combat abilities to battle the Corrupted and other hostile forces.
Narrative Style: Visual Novel Meets High Stakes Action
The game’s story unfolds through visual novel style storytelling, complete with dialogue interactions, cutscenes, and mission-based storytelling. While the main campaign focuses on the war against the Corrupted, players also uncover deeper lore surrounding rival factions, hidden conspiracies, and the mysteries of the Punishing Virus.
Core Gameplay Features
Combat System
At the heart of Punishing: Gray Raven lies its fast paced, real time combat system, combining fluid hack and slash mechanics with strategic decision-making.
- Dynamic Hack-and-Slash Action: Players control one Construct at a time while seamlessly switching between teammates for devastating combo attacks.
- The Ping System: Abilities are activated by chaining colored orbs (Pings), matching three orbs of the same color unleashes enhanced skills.
- Matrix Evasion Mechanic: Precise dodging triggers a slow motion effect, temporarily freezing enemies and allowing counterattacks.
Character Progression & Customization
Constructs can be enhanced and customized through multiple progression systems:
- Leveling & Promotion: Upgrading a Construct increases their stats and unlocks new abilities.
- Memory System: Players equip Memories (equippable chips) that provide stat boosts and special effects.
- Team Building: Constructs have distinct roles (DPS, Support, Tank) and elemental affinities, making strategic team composition essential.
- Gacha System: New Constructs and weapons are obtained via a gacha based recruitment system with a pity mechanic ensuring character unlocks.
Story Mode & Exploration
Beyond combat, Punishing: Gray Raven features a rich, evolving story campaign:
- Mission-Based Progression: Players complete a variety of story-driven missions, from main campaign quests to side stories exploring individual Construct backgrounds.
- Faction Conflicts: Encounters with other human factions, like the Ascendants, add depth to the story.
- Event-Based Story Expansions: Limited time events introduce additional lore and exclusive rewards.
Housing System
A lighter, social aspect of the game comes in the form of the Dormitory System, allowing players to:
- Decorate Dormitories: Customize living spaces for Constructs with furniture and decorations.
- Improve Construct Morale: A happy Construct earns in game bonuses and interacts with the player.

What Sets Punishing: Gray Raven Apart?
While Honkai Impact 3rd focuses on team based strategic action and Aether Gazer blends shooter mechanics with RPG elements, Punishing: Gray Raven distinguishes itself with its:
- Fast-paced, skill based combat featuring the Ping system and Matrix-style dodging.
- Smoother, more responsive action mechanics compared to Honkai Impact 3rd’s multi character swapping system.
- Cyberpunk-inspired post-apocalyptic setting, differentiating it from the more futuristic fantasy themes of the other two titles.
